Air Fryer Frittata Recipe (Super Easy Breakfast)

Elevate your breakfast with this easy and healthy air fryer frittata recipe. Perfect for busy mornings, it combines your favorite veggies and eggs into a delicious, fuss-free meal.
Prep Time5 minutes
Cook Time15 minutes
Total Time20 minutes
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Servings: 2 servings
Calories: 378kcal

Ingredients

  • 6 whole eggs
  • 2 white mushrooms
  • whole tomato
  • 1 chicken sausage
  • 3 tbsp feta cheese
  • 1 green onion
  • ½ avocado
  • Salt + black pepper
  • Garlic powder
  • Paprika
  • Red chili flakes

Instructions

  • Start by dicing up your veggies into bite-sized pieces. If you’re using harder vegetables like carrots or broccoli, you might want to give them a quick sauté first to soften them up. Using leftover veggies is also a great option.
  • Take your air fryer tray or dish and line with parchment paper. Then lightly grease it with cooking spray or a bit of olive oil. This helps in preventing the frittata from sticking to the pan.
  • Crack your whole eggs onto the air fryer tray. Then add all your chopped veggies of choice. Finally season your frittata with salt, black pepper, garlic powder, paprika, and red chili flakes.
  • Preheat your air fryer to 350 degrees F if it requires preheating. Place the pan in the air fryer basket. Cook for about 15-20 minutes, or until the frittata is set and the top is golden. The cooking time can vary based on your air fryer model, so it’s a good idea to start checking around the 13-minute mark.
  • Once done, carefully remove the pan from the air fryer and let the frittata cool for 2-3 minutes. This makes it easier to slice and serve.
